WebIn Australia, only male Sydney Funnel Web Spiders and Redback Spiders have caused human deaths, but none have occurred since antivenoms were made available in 1981. … Web16 aug. 2012 · Huntsman spiders are widespread in Australia. They are famous for being the big (up to 15cm leg-span) scary, hairy, black spiders bolting out from behind the curtains. WebThe huntsman spider has all the hallmarks that incite arachnophobia in humans. They’re hairy, long-legged, usually dark coloured to support nocturnal camouflage, and have a habit of scuttling about at night.
